1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the coordinate system used for plotting points?

Back

The Cartesian coordinate system, which consists of two perpendicular axes: the x-axis (horizontal) and the y-axis (vertical).

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How do you plot the point (-2, -6)?

Back

Move left 2 units on the x-axis and down 6 units on the y-axis.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Which quadrant contains the point (4, -6)?

Back

Quadrant IV, where x is positive and y is negative.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What does the first number in a coordinate pair represent?

Back

The x-coordinate, which indicates the horizontal position.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What does the second number in a coordinate pair represent?

Back

The y-coordinate, which indicates the vertical position.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the origin in a coordinate system?

Back

The point (0, 0) where the x-axis and y-axis intersect.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How do you identify a point in the coordinate plane?

Back

By its coordinates (x, y), where x is the horizontal position and y is the vertical position.
